ОТВЕТ НА ВОПРОСЫ 9 КЛАСС


1.Что такое массив?
Виды массивов?
Описание массивов?
2.Способы заполнения массивов?
3. Способы вывода массива?
4. Вычисление суммы элементов массива?
5. Нахождение наибольшего элемента массива?
6. Нахождение наименьшего элемента массива?
7. Нахождение элемента с заданным свойствами?
8. Сортировка массива?

Ответы

Ответ дал: restIess
0

Массив - набор однотипных элементов, связанных общим именем (именем массива)

Виды: Одномерные, многомерные

Описание массивов различается в разных языках программирования, расскажу о C++ и Pascal

C++:

int a[20], так мы получим массив из 20 целых чисел с именем "a"

Pascal:

mas = array[1..10] of integer;

Так мы получим массив состоящий из 10 целочисленных элементов с именем "mas"

2. Способов можно придумать бесконечное количество, но если обобщить, то мы имеем:

  • Ввод элементов с клавиатуры
  • Элементы получают случайное значение
  • Выбираем значения по определенном признаку

3. Тут тоже по сути много способов, но можем выделить следующие:

  • В строку/столбец без комментариев
  • С комментариями

4. Чтобы вычислить сумму элементов массива нам нужно взять дополнительную переменную для суммы, затем пройтись по всему массиву с помощью цикла и на каждом проходе прибавлять i-тый элемент массива к сумме.

5. Здесь нам нужно будет взять переменную для хранения максимального значения, присвоим ей значение 1 элемента массива, затем запустим цикл, в котором будет проверять, что больше, наша переменная с максимум или i-тый элемент, если же i-тый элемент больше максимума, то присваиваем максимуму значение i-того элемента.

6. Аналогично максимуму, только искать будем минимальное значение.

7. Нам нужно запустить цикл, который будет пробегать по всему массиву, в нём мы будем проверять каждый элемент на какие-либо свойства.

8. Способов сортировок очень много, давайте рассмотрим самую простую сортировку - "Пузырёк". Пробегаем по массиву с помощью вложенного цикла и сравниваем соседние элементы, если мы имеем пару неотсортированных элементов, то меняем их местами и так до конца. Данная сортировка является не только самой простой, но и одной из самых медленных и "глупых", так как реализовать ее может практически любой, а временная сложность ее не впечатляет


sholpan1202s: hhh
Вас заинтересует